Here is the truth on BYU being better w/out Emery and Mika and Haws' production
I realize this post is for a select few special souls on this board who can't grasp Coach Norman Dale's advice for the people of Hickory "I would hope you would support who we are. Not, who we are not." and feel the need to bring up Emery and Mika after what seems to be every freakin' game.

Let's look at TJ first. Is his shooting down? Of course! Everything else is up across the board from last year though for TJ. Rebounds? Check. Assists? Yep. Blocks are up too. Steals are the same. He is fouling at a smaller rate this year and he has less TO/game. It is fairly obvious that his defense is getting better too. But his shooting is down. The bottom line is that of everyone on this team, the style of play is effecting TJ more than anyone, IMO. A style of offense that he has played for a long time is gone. Gunning from anywhere, good looks or bad looks, shoot early in the clock..... The looks and shoots he has been conditioned to take for years are being changed. Giving extra effort on the defensive side is being asked too and he is answering. He is being asked and challenged to play a different brand of basketball and he is doing it. He is playing team basketball. There is a reason he is playing 33 minutes a game (more than anyone but Childs). This coaching staff is holding players accountable and the minutes played are a reward for his play despite his shot being pretty bad at times.

Now switch to Mika and Emery. Last year was not a Mika and Emery problem. It was a team problem that started with Rose and went all the way down through every seat on the bench. It was a coaches and players problem. Haws was one part of that problem. TJ has bought into this new culture and he is delivering what the coaches want. Are their some warts still in his game that he is trying to get rid of? Of course! It's he trying to adapt and play this new brand? Yep. So if TJ is doing it, why wouldn't emery and mika? Why wouldn't they be held accountable? Nick was apart of this team until the season started. He bought into this new face of basketball. He bought into being accountable. Would there have been some lingering habits? Of course! Would nick have struggled to find his spot in the offense? At times, yes. But he bought in.

This is a the '17-'18 cougs. We are not better because nick and mika are gone. We are better because Rose saw a culture problem (even with Mika leaving) and made changes. This is a new brand set forth by the coaches and the players are answering. We are 11 games into a completely different basketball scheme and culture on both ends of the court. It has nothing to do with mika leaving and emery sitting out and everything to do with coaching and the players respecting and being accountable to the expectations.

So if you like TJ making 30 foot 3's 5 seconds into the shot clock with a defender in front of him, go watch games from last year on demand with BYUtv. If you want to watch TJ play team ball and play within an offense and put forth effort on defense, watch the games this year. Is it a work in progress? Yes. But it is causing him to be a much more rounded player and the coaches see that. The shot will come as he gets more comfortable.
